Lindsey Graham is an American politician and lawyer who has served as a United States Senator for South Carolina since 2003. He is a member of the Republican Party. Graham is known for his conservative views and his support for the military. He is also known for his close friendship with the late Senator John McCain.
One of the most frequently asked questions about Lindsey Graham is whether or not he has children. The answer to this question is no. Graham has never been married and does not have any children.
